If you anticipate only … WebDec 14, 2024 · In a traditional health insurance plan, you have copays until you meet the deductible. In a high-deductible health plan, you pay all of the medical costs until you meet your deductible. The choice between a high-deductible plan and a traditional plan depends on your budget and how often you go to the doctor. A health savings account can offset ...

Web2 days ago · A high-deductible health plan (HDHP) is a health insurance plan with a deductible of at least $1,500 for an individual or $3,000 for a family. Any health plan, like a PPO or HMO, can be an HDHP. WebA high deductible plan (HDHP) can be combined with a health savings account (HSA), allowing you to pay for certain medical expenses with money free from federal taxes. For 2024, the IRS defines a high deductible health plan as any plan with a deductible of at least $1,400 for an individual or $2,800 for a family. An HDHP’s total yearly out-of ...
